Transaction 57da07b49489f427448383081775bed1370eaafe1439c399404e59ca974e2631

1 Input
2 Outputs
  • 57da07b49489f427448383081775bed1370eaafe1439c399404e59ca974e2631:0
  • value  73770501
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 57da07b49489f427448383081775bed1370eaafe1439c399404e59ca974e2631:1
  • value  29525000
    address  3LBxW3GtfGPUknZB45WhpFf9ptw565x1og